Cost Saving
IP Networking -Saving Running Costs-
Features and Benefits
No need to change the PBX settings when
phones are moved to another place.
Recommended for:
Companies with a need to change their office
layout on occasion.
Companies which have an LAN network system.
Growing companies
Office
2F
1F
IP proprietary telephones
Simple move
23
By using IP phones as extensions, there is no need to change the settings of the PBX each time the office layout is changed.

Panasonic KX-NS500 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Analog ExtensionsUp to 64
VoIP SupportYes
System TypeHybrid IP-PBX
Power SupplyAC 100-240V, 50/60Hz
Operating Temperature0°C to 40°C
Humidity10% to 90% (non-condensing)
Maximum Extensions288
IP Extensions128
VoIP Channels64
SIP Trunks64
NetworkingYes, supports networking
Built-in ApplicationsCall Center
ExpandabilityYes, via expansion cards and cabinets
Supported ProtocolsSIP, H.323, MGCP
Dimensions430 x 88 x 367 mm
